What will happen if battery is shorted and grounded?

If a battery is "shorted", meaning that its terminals are connected together through a low resistance, high current flows in the connection and the battery becomes discharged very soon. It makes no difference whether any part of the battery is connected to ground.

Why would your car be driving fine then all electrics start shutting down and car stops while waiting at lights when you have a brand new battery?

Chances are the alternator is defective. a shorted armature, or shorted or burnt out field. Check battery voltage, if suddenly is discharged, this should confirm the a defective alternator or broken alternator belt. Also check for blown fuse or melted fusible link or tripped circuit breaker in starting and charging system.
